How to Find a Job Without Experience

Search for - Entry-level - or - Junior - positions in your field of interest.

1. Target Entry-Level Job

Highlight transferable skills from coursework, volunteering, or hobbies on your resume.

2. Sharpen your skill

You need to tailor your resume to each job, emphasizing relevant skills and achievements.

3. Craft a Strong Resume

Connect with professionals on LinkedIn and attend industry events to build your network.

4. Network Actively

Explore job boards, job sites and company websites for open positions.

5. Online Platform

Research about the company in detail and decide that how your skill can benefit the company.

6. Prepare for Interview

Be prepared, dress professionally, and arrive early. Show confidence, answer clearly, and ask thoughtful questions. Make a lasting impression!

7. Appear for Interview

Send a thank-you email after each interview, reiterating your interest.

8. Follow Up

Landing a job takes time. Keep applying and learning from each experience.

9. Be Persistent
